All about Grand Barbe dive site

Depth max
23 m
Visibility
to 25 m
To get to this dive site requires a long distance boat trip. The depth of the site is from 12m/39ft to 23m/75ft and there is a medium current.

What to see

The site features granite rocks and an abundant marine life including reef fish, schooling bat fish, giant moray eels, hump-head parrotfish, napoleon wrasses, turtles, cat fish, schooling big-eye snappers, schooling giant barracudas, schooling jacks, octopus, white-tip reef sharks, nurse sharks, giant marble stingrays, eagle rays, giant cod, groupers, oriental sweetlips, lionfish, scorpion fish, swim-troughs, soft corals, lobsters and schooling fusiliers.

When to go diving in Grand Barbe

The water temperature is around 28C/82F in March and 26C/78F in September. The air temperature ranges from 26C/79F to 30C/86F in the winter and from 23C/73F to 26C/78F in the summer.
